19.01.2012 DESIGN
A young designer, Mathias van de Walle, out of the C.A.D., proposed to Veuve Clicquot a foldable champagne bucket. He has made the first protoype in a school project. The famous champagne firm has chosen to publish this beautiful object. Congratulation read more
